Statutory Instruments

1995 No. 3162

REGISTRATION OF BIRTHS, DEATHS, MARRIAGES, ETC.

ENGLAND AND WALES

The Registration of Births, Deaths and Marriages (Fees) Order 1995

Made

6th December 1995

Laid before Parliament

14th December 1995

Coming into force

1st April 1996

The Secretary of State for Health, in exercise of the powers conferred by section 5(1) and (2) of, and paragraphs 1 and 2 of Schedule 3 to the Public Expenditure and Receipts Act 1968(1) and now vested in him(2) and of all other powers enabling him in that behalf, hereby makes the following Order—

Citation and commencement

1.—(1) This Order may be cited as the Registration of Births, Deaths and Marriages (Fees) Order 1995 and shall come into force on 1st April 1996.

(2) In this Order a reference to a numbered column is to the column in the Schedule to this Order bearing that number.

Fees Payable

2.  In each enactment specified in column (2) in relation to which there is an entry in column (5), for the sum specified in column (5) there is substituted the sum specified in relation to it in column (4); and the fee payable in England and Wales under each of the enactments specified in column (2) in respect of a matter or case specified in column (3) is that specified in relation to that matter or case in column (4).

Revocation of the Registration of Births, Deaths and Marriages (Fees) Order 1994

3.  The Registration of Births, Deaths and Marriages (Fees) Order 1994(3) (under which the fees payable were as respectively set out in column (5) of the Schedule to this Order) is hereby revoked.

Signed by authority of the Secretary of State for Health,

John Horam

Parliamentary Under-Secretary of State

Department of Health

6th December 1995

Article 2

SCHEDULEFEES PAYABLE FROM 1ST APRIL 1996

(1)(2)(3)(4)(5)
Enactment specifying feesMatter or case for which fee is payableFee as from 1st April 1996Old fee (where different)
1855 c. 81Places of Worship Registration Act 1855
Section 5Certification of place of meeting for religious worship£17.00
1887 c. 40Savings Banks Act 1887
Section 10(4)Certificate of birth, death or marriage for purposes of certain Acts£2.00
1944 c. 31Education Act 1944
Section 94(1)Copy of entry in birth register for purposes of certain Acts£2.00
1949 c. 76Marriage Act 1949
Section 27(6)Entry in marriage notice book£19.00
Section 27(7)(5)Attendance of superintendent registrar other than at his office for purpose of being given notice of marriage of house-bound or detained person£37.00£35.00
Section 32(5)(6)Licence for marriage£45.00
Section 41(6)(7)Registration of buildings for solemnization of marriages£93.00
Section 51(1)(8)

Fee of registrar for attending marriage—

(i)

at register office

£25.00£23.00

(ii)at registered building or at the place where a house-bound or detained person usually resides

£35.00£33.00
Section 51(2)(9)Fee of superintendent registrar attending marriage at the place where a house-bound or detained person usually resides£37.00£35.00
Section 57(4)(10)Sum paid to incumbent, etc. for every entry contained in quarterly certified copies of entries of marriage£1.80
Section 63(1)(b)

Certified copy of entry issued under that subsection—

(i)

when application is made at the time of registering or to a registrar

£2.50

(ii)in any other case

£5.50
Section 64(2)(a)General search of indexes of register books kept by superintendent registrars£17.00£16.00
Section 64(2)(c)Certified copy of entry issued under that subsection£5.50
Section 65(2)(c)Certified copy of entry, following a search of indexes kept at General Register Office£6.00
1953 c. 20Births and Deaths Registration Act 1953
Section 13(2)Issue of certificate of baptism£1.00
Section 30(2)(c)Certified copy of entry, following search of indexes kept at General Register Office£6.00
Section 31(2)(a)General search of indexes kept by superintendent registrars£17.00£16.00
Section 31(2)(c)Certified copy of entry issued under that subsection£5.50
Section 32(c)Certified copy of entry in registers kept by registrars£2.50
Section 33(1)

(i)Short certificate of birth obtained at the time of registration, or if more than one such certificate is obtained, the first of these

NIL

(ii)Any other short certificate of birth obtained from a registrar

£2.00

(iii)A short certificate of birth obtained from a superintendent registrar

£3.00

(iv)A short certificate of birth obtained from the Registrar General

£4.00
1961 c. 34Factories Act 1961
Section 178(1)Extract of entry in birth register for purposes of that Act£2.00
1992 c. 5Social Security Administration Act 1992
Section 124(3)Certificate of birth, death or marriage for purposes of certain Acts£2.00

Explanatory Note

(This note is not part of the Order)

This Order specifies the fees payable under the Acts relating to the registration of births, deaths and marriages and associated matters, from 1st April 1996.

Where fees have increased, the fees payable both before and after that date are set out in the Schedule.
